Increase running frequency for cppsuite-stress-test and workgen-test Evergreen tasks

XMLWordPrintableJSON

    • Type: Improvement
    • Resolution: Unresolved
    • Priority: Major - P3
    • None
    • Affects Version/s: None
    • Component/s: Evergreen
    • None
    • Storage Engines
    • 18.554
    • None
    • 1

      Context

      As part of WTBUILD-344 to increase the success rate of finding a stable wiredtiger commit and not failing auto-triggers, we need tasks in a few build variants to be scheduled to run more frequently to achieve the "75% tasks scheduled" stable commit selection criteria.

      Current state:

      • ubuntu2004-stress-tests: .cppsuite-stress-test (10 tasks) at batchtime:720 → 27/37 = 72.97% (BELOW threshold)
      • ubuntu2004: .workgen-test (22 tasks) at batchtime:1440 → 102/130 = 78.5% (narrow margin)

      Changes to test/evergreen.yml

      • ubuntu2004-stress-tests: .cppsuite-stress-test batchtime 720120 (every 2 hours)
      • ubuntu2004: .workgen-test batchtime 1440120 (every 2 hours)

      Leave model-test-long* and csuite-long-running at batchtime:1440.

            Assignee:
            Luke Chen
            Reporter:
            Luke Chen
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ated: